Transaction 21cc11c7d696bfc307bee0ff6afc3d31379303fb2af49291e0117c7a9f29a630
1 Input
1 Output
-
21cc11c7d696bfc307bee0ff6afc3d31379303fb2af49291e0117c7a9f29a630:0
- value
- 603869
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dff5ae343cce37d5b22c9ad71c584859913836e0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MRBzxY5CubQRp9RzHtfwAwPc346LG93EP